services: base: Deprecate 'host-name-service' procedure.
* doc/guix.texi (operating-system Reference): Reorder cross-reference. Add an anchor to be used ... (Base services): ... here by host-name-service-type. Document host-name-service-type. * gnu/services/base.scm: Export host-name-service-type. (host-name-service): Deprecate procedure. * gnu/system.scm (operating-system-default-essential-services): Use host-name-service-type. Signed-off-by: Ludovic Courtès <ludo@gnu.org>
